红帽高效查远程端口,一步到位解决难题!
红帽查看远程端口

首页 2024-06-25 18:26:33



红帽系统下远程端口查看与管理的专业解析 在红帽Linux系统中,远程端口的查看与管理是系统管理员进行网络故障排查和系统安全配置的重要工作之一

    通过对远程端口的监测和管理,可以及时发现并解决网络通信中的问题,同时增强系统的安全性

    本文将详细介绍在红帽系统中如何查看远程端口以及相关的管理策略

     一、远程端口查看的重要性 在Linux系统中,每个服务都会占用一个或多个端口进行通信

    当需要进行远程连接时,远程端口的状态和可用性直接影响到连接的成功与否

    因此,对于系统管理员来说,能够快速准确地查看远程端口的状态是至关重要的

    通过查看远程端口,可以了解哪些端口正在被使用,哪些端口处于空闲状态,以及端口的通信状态等信息

    这些信息对于故障排查、安全审计以及性能优化等方面都具有重要意义

     二、红帽系统中远程端口的查看方法 在红帽Linux系统中,有多种方法可以用于查看远程端口的状态

    其中,最常用的是使用netstat命令

    netstat命令用于显示网络连接、路由表、接口统计等网络相关信息

    通过结合不同的参数,可以实现对远程端口的详细查看

     首先,可以通过以下命令查看系统中所有TCP和UDP协议的监听端口及其状态: netstat -tuln 该命令中,-t参数表示显示TCP协议的信息,-u参数表示显示UDP协议的信息,-l参数表示仅显示监听状态的端口,-n参数表示以数字形式显示地址和端口号,而不是尝试解析为主机名、服务名等

    执行该命令后,系统将列出当前所有处于监听状态的端口及其相关信息,包括协议类型、本地地址和端口号、远程地址和端口号(对于已建立的连接)以及状态等

     如果需要查看特定端口的监听状态,可以结合grep命令进行过滤

    例如,要查看端口号为22的SSH服务的监听状态,可以执行以下命令: netstat -tuln | grep :22 此外,如果想要查看系统中所有端口的占用情况(包括已经建立连接的端口),可以执行以下命令: netstat -tulna 该命令将列出系统中所有端口的详细信息,包括已建立连接的端口和未建立连接的端口

     除了netstat命令外,还可以使用其他工具如ss命令、lsof命令等来查看端口信息

    这些工具提供了不同的输出格式和功能选项,可以根据具体需求进行选择

     三、远程端口的管理策略 在查看远程端口的基础上,系统管理员还需要制定相应的管理策略来确保系统的安全性和稳定性

    以下是一些建议的管理策略: 1. 端口开放原则:遵循最小权限原则,仅开放必要的端口

    对于不必要的端口,应将其关闭或设置为仅允许特定IP地址访问

     2. 定期审查:定期审查系统中开放的端口列表,确保没有未授权的端口被开放

     3. 使用防火墙:配置防火墙规则,限制对特定端口的访问

    只允许必要的IP地址和端口范围通过防火墙

     4. 日志记录:启用端口访问日志记录功能,以便在发生安全事件时进行追溯和分析

     通过遵循以上管理策略,可以有效地管理红帽系统中的远程端口,提高系统的安全性和稳定性

    同时,对于系统管理员来说,不断学习和掌握新的端口管理技术和工具也是非常重要的

    只有不断更新知识、提升技能,才能更好地应对不断变化的网络环境和安全挑战